Denison council unanimously approves FY2025 year-end budget amendments and FY2026 appropriations

Denison City Council · December 2, 2025

The Denison City Council unanimously approved fiscal year 2025 year-end budget amendments and five appropriations totaling about $305,000 to be carried into the FY2026 budget; staff reported net general fund revenues exceeded expectations by roughly $528,000.

The Denison City Council on Dec. 1 unanimously approved staff-recommended year-end adjustments to the fiscal 2025 budget and appropriations to move unspent funds into fiscal 2026.

Miss Lori Ostwald, who presented the year-end summary, said staff identified three types of changes — revenue amendments, expense amendments and appropriations — and that individual amendment lines totaled about $3,100,000 while net general fund revenues finished roughly $528,000 above budget. "The amendments themselves total $3,100,000 there in yellow," Ostwald said.
